/ˈteɪbəl/ noun one. a flat horizontal slab or board, normally supported by a number of legs, on which objects could possibly be placed linked adjective mensal two. this kind of slab or board on which food stuff is served: we have been six at table
It is time to phase exterior, breath from the fresh new air, and enjoy the most out of the outdoor House. Whether producing an oasis of solitude or a place to gather with family and friends, Amazon gives unlimited patio furniture prospects--great for poolside, scaled-down Areas, and grand decks and lavish lawns alike.
Consider the subsequent points when selecting the best way to implement this pattern: Table storage is comparatively affordable to implement so the associated fee overhead of storing copy information shouldn't be An important worry. Nonetheless, you need to constantly Assess the expense of your design and style dependant on your predicted storage demands and only add duplicate entities to support the queries your customer software will execute. Because the secondary index entities are saved in the same partition as the initial entities, you should make sure that you do not exceed the scalability targets for an individual partition. You may keep your copy entities per one another by using EGTs to update the two copies with the entity atomically.
The EmployeeIDs house has a listing of employee ids for workers with the last title stored from the RowKey. The subsequent techniques define the procedure you ought to follow if you are including a whole new employee if you are applying the second selection. In this instance, we have been introducing an worker with Id 000152 and a last title Jones inside the Sales Division: Retrieve the index entity that has a PartitionKey price "Gross sales" plus the RowKey price "Jones." Conserve the ETag of this entity to employ in stage 2. Create an entity team transaction (that's, a batch operation) that inserts The brand new employee entity (PartitionKey value "Sales" and RowKey price "000152"), and updates the index entity (PartitionKey worth "Gross sales" and RowKey benefit "Jones") by introducing the new employee id into the listing in the EmployeeIDs subject. To learn more about entity group transactions, see Entity Team Transactions. In the event the entity team transaction fails as a consequence of an optimistic concurrency mistake (another person has just modified the index entity), right here then you should get started around at action 1 all over again. You can utilize an identical method of deleting an staff In case you are employing the second choice.
Your outdoor furniture need to showcase site here your own type even though introducing versatility in your patio or pool place. Our lineup offers you important source the pliability required to pick the comfortable, eye-catching parts that friends and family will like. With all-weather wicker sectionals and sofas, you will have the best mix of sturdiness and comfort all calendar year lengthy. Pair with natural polyester canvas cushions in your favorite hue and printed pillows to add a pop of color.
Discover with this instance how the two the PartitionKey and RowKey are compound keys. The PartitionKey uses each the Section and staff id to distribute the logging across many partitions. Problems and things to consider
Observe that making use of an "or" to specify a filter dependant on RowKey values results in a partition scan and isn't handled as a range question. Hence, it is best to avoid queries that use filters for instance:
To structure scalable and performant tables you must look at a variety of components such as overall performance, scalability, and cost. In case you have Earlier made schemas for relational databases, these issues are going to be acquainted to you personally, but whilst there are numerous similarities concerning the Azure Table provider storage model and relational products, In addition there are numerous significant variations. sun lounge These distinctions typically produce quite distinctive models that will look counter-intuitive or Incorrect to someone acquainted with relational databases, but which do make good perception if you are designing for any NoSQL important/benefit shop such as the Azure Table services.
An orderly arrangement of knowledge, In particular a single through which the information are arranged in columns and rows within an essentially rectangular form.
Lastly, if there were no errors within the past techniques, the worker part deletes the concealed concept from your queue. In this instance, action 4 inserts the worker into your Archive table. It could insert the worker to the blob from the Blob services or a file inside of a file system. Recovering from failures
The Switch and Merge methods are unsuccessful if the entity doesn't exist. As a substitute, You need to use the InsertOrReplace and InsertOrMerge procedures that develop a new entity if it would not exist. Working with heterogeneous entity kinds
If Additionally you want in order to retrieve a summary of staff entities based on the value of another non-exceptional property, like their final name, you will need to utilize a a lot less productive partition scan to seek out matches as an alternative to employing an index to seem them up directly. This is because the table company isn't going to offer secondary indexes. Answer
You can certainly modify this code so which the update runs asynchronously as follows: private static async Endeavor SimpleEmployeeUpsertAsync(CloudTable employeeTable, EmployeeEntity personnel)
The area Table Layout learn the facts here now Designs describes some in depth design styles for that Table assistance and highlights some these trade-offs. In exercise, you can find that a lot of styles optimized for querying entities also get the job done well for modifying entities. Optimizing the performance of insert, update, and delete functions